In order to determine which states tax their residents most aggressively, WalletHub compared the 50 states based on the three components of state tax burden — property taxes, individual income taxes, and sales and excise taxes — as a share of total personal income.
Tax Burden in Rhode Island (1=Highest, 25=Avg.):
6th – Overall Tax Burden (10.20%)
4th– Property Tax Burden (4.75%)
27th – Individual Income Tax Burden (2.30%)
34th– Total Sales & Excise Tax Burden (3.15%)
While Rhode Island landed at 6th, New York landed at the worst (1st) and Alaska landed at the lowest tax burden (50th).
